Overview
The ADSP-21262SKBC-200 is a member of the third-generation of SHARC (Super Harvard Architecture) programmable Digital Signal Processors (DSPs) from Analog Devices Inc. This DSP is designed to provide high performance and integration, making it suitable for a wide range of applications including high-quality audio, automotive entertainment systems, voice recognition, medical appliances, and measurement devices. The ADSP-21262 is based on a 200MHz (5ns instruction cycle time) SIMD SHARC core, capable of executing complex algorithms such as Fast Fourier Transform (FFT) operations with high efficiency.
Key Specifications
Specification | Details |
---|---|
Processor Core | 200MHz (5ns) SIMD SHARC Core |
Performance | 1.2 GFLOPS, 1024-point complex FFT in 46μs |
Data Types | IEEE-compatible 32-bit floating-point, 40-bit floating-point, 32-bit fixed-point |
Memory | 2Mbit on-chip dual-ported SRAM, 4Mbit mask-programmable ROM |
Bandwidth | 2.4 Gbyte/sec on-chip bandwidth |
Serial Ports | 6 independent Serial Ports (SPORTS) supporting DSP Serial mode, I2S mode, Left Justified Sample pair mode, and TDM mode |
DMA Channels | 22 Zero-overhead DMA channels |
Interfaces | SPI compatible interface, 16-bit Parallel Port |
Timers | Four timers: 1 core and 3 general purpose timers supporting PWM generation, PWM capture/pulse width measurement, and external event watchdog mode |
Package | 136-ball BGA (12mm × 12mm) and 144-lead LQFP (20mm × 20mm) |
Key Features
- Code compatible with all SHARC DSPs, ensuring ease of migration and development.
- Digital Applications Interface (DAI) for simplified I/O system development, allowing complete software programmability of various peripherals.
- Flexible Signal Routing Unit (SRU) for configurable connectivity between DAI components.
- Support for multiple serial communication modes and a 16-bit parallel port.
- 22 zero-overhead DMA channels for fast data transfers without processor intervention.
- Four timers with various modes including PWM generation, PWM capture, and external event watchdog.
- PLL capable of a variety of software multiplier ratios for flexible clock management.
